Section 487:16-a – Exotic Aquatic Weed Prohibition.
487:16-a Exotic Aquatic Weed Prohibition. – No exotic aquatic weeds shall be offered for sale, distributed, sold, imported, purchased, propagated, transported, or introduced in the state. The commissioner may exempt any exotic aquatic weed from any of the prohibitions of this section consistent with the purpose of this subdivision. Source. 1997, 185:3, eff. Jan. […]
Section 487:16-b – Exotic Aquatic Weed Penalties.
487:16-b Exotic Aquatic Weed Penalties. – It shall be unlawful to offer for sale, distribute, sell, import, purchase, propagate, negligently transport, or introduce exotic aquatic weeds into New Hampshire waterbodies. Notwithstanding RSA 487:7, any person engaging in such an activity shall be guilty of a violation. Source. 1999, 204:3, eff. Jan. 1, 2000. 2016, […]

Section 487:16-d – Draining of Water Conveyances.
487:16-d Draining of Water Conveyances. – I. When leaving waters of the state, a person shall drain his or her boat and other water-related equipment that holds water, including live wells and bilges. II. Section 487:12 – Operation After Suspension.
487:12 Operation After Suspension. – No boat shall be operated upon any waters of this state after its certificate of registration has been taken up for violation of this chapter other than from the point at which said certificate was taken up to a permanent mooring. Section 487:14 – Subsequent Registrations.
487:14 Subsequent Registrations. – Applications for original or renewal of certificates of registration from the department of safety, division of motor vehicles, shall contain a statement subject to the penalties of perjury that the boat described in such application is equipped in compliance with this chapter.
